Timebase

A calmer way to visualize & plan across timezones

0 upvotes ProductivityMay 2026

Timebase offers a visually stunning and intuitive way to understand and plan across different time zones. By allowing users to scrub through the day, it displays real-time lighting and sky colors for various cities worldwide, making it easier to grasp time differences at a glance. Its innovative color-coded sky visualization provides an immersive experience, ideal for remote teams, global collaborators, or anyone managing schedules across multiple regions. The integrated meeting planner helps identify optimal times for group calls, while live countdowns keep track of upcoming events. With offline capability, iCloud syncing, and a focus on privacy—no signups or analytics—Timebase emphasizes simplicity and user control. Its upcoming availability on iPad, Mac, and Apple Watch promises even more seamless cross-device planning. Perfect for professionals, travelers, or global families, it stands out as a calming, aesthetically pleasing tool for managing the complexities of worldwide scheduling.

Claude Computer Use

Enable Claude to use your computer to complete tasks

668 upvotes ProductivityMar 2026

Claude Computer Use by Anthropic is an innovative AI-powered tool that transforms your AI assistant into an autonomous computer operator. By enabling Claude to perform tasks such as clicking, typing, browsing, and running applications, it bridges AI reasoning with real-world action, making complex workflows more efficient. Designed for professionals, researchers, and busy individuals, this tool allows users to delegate routine or time-consuming tasks directly from their phones, freeing up valuable time and reducing manual effort. Its ability to autonomously execute commands on your Mac or other computers makes it a unique integration of AI intelligence and practical productivity. Whether managing emails, generating reports, or navigating web content, Claude Computer Use offers a seamless way to enhance daily workflows with AI-driven automation.
